				  Help please  
					
						I have  just  reinstalled SO4  and  tried  to  put in Tommy's  graphics  but  get  no  difference.
 Could  someone please  talk me  throught it  real  basic  stages  for  a  70 year old PC  dummy.
 I  feel I  am  deifinetely missing out  as my  race  graphics  are  far below  the  standard shown in supercats pic.
 I am on MSN or  skype if  that is  the  easy  way  to  instruct me.
 I have  got it patched  to 184.

						 all you got to do is download tommys pack, then pull the folder gfx that is in his download out drop it on to your desktop.
 
 now you go to computor go to your c drive double click that then go to your program files find the folder starters orders 4 double click that and now drop your gfx folder from tommys download into there and when prompted just say yes to over write previous folder and files this will then replace the old gfx folder with the new one from tommys and you will have the new graphics.
 
 
 hope this is explained well enough for you.
